The primary problems addressed by wood window services involve structural deterioration and operational inefficiencies. Over time, exposure to moisture, temperature fluctuations, and general wear can cause wood to warp, rot, or develop mold. These issues can lead to drafts, difficulty opening or closing windows, and increased energy costs due to poor insulation. Wood window specialists help resolve these problems by replacing compromised sections, sealing gaps, and restoring the integrity of the window frames. This not only improves the appearance but also enhances energy efficiency and security for the property.

Window Repair Costs - Repair expenses for wood windows typically range from $150 to $600 per window, depending on the extent of damage and materials needed. For minor repairs, costs may be closer to $150, while extensive work could approach $600 or more.
Refinishing and Painting - Refinishing or painting wood windows generally costs between $200 and $800 per window. The price varies based on the size of the window and the complexity of the finish required.
Replacement Window Installation - Installing new wood windows can range from $500 to over $1,500 per window, including labor and materials. Custom sizes and styles may increase the overall costs.
Labor and Service Fees - Service fees for wood window work typically fall between $100 and $300 per hour, with total costs depending on the scope of the project and local contractor rates. Costs can vary based on the complexity of the job and location.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
